10 February 2026, Hyderabad
The ICAR South Zone Sports Tournament was inaugurated today at the RSC Grounds, Secunderabad. The four-day tournament, being organized by the ICAR–National Academy of Agricultural Research Management, will be held from 10 to 13 February 2026.
Dr. B. Venkateswarlu, Former Vice-Chancellor of Vasantrao Naik Marathwada Krishi Vidyapeeth, graced the occasion as Chief Guest and formally declared the tournament open. In his inaugural address, he emphasized that teamwork and sportsmanship are essential qualities in sports and equally vital in research within ICAR institutions. He stated that participation in sports promotes a healthy lifestyle and encouraged players to uphold the spirit of sportsmanship even beyond the playing field.

Ms. N. Bhavani Sri, IAS, Secretary of the National Turmeric Board, attended as Guest of Honour. She lauded ICAR personnel for their significant contributions to the nation’s agricultural development and encouraged participants to create lasting memories during the tournament. She highlighted that such events provide a unique opportunity for personnel across all cadres and hierarchies to compete and interact on a common platform.
Dr. Gopal Lal, Acting Director, ICAR-NAARM, addressed the participants and underscored the importance of sports in fostering physical fitness and mental well-being, contributing to enhanced professional performance. He advised the players to maintain discipline and exemplify good sportsmanship throughout the tournament.
Earlier, Dr. K. Srinivas, Organizing Secretary, ICAR-NAARM, welcomed the dignitaries and participants.

The tournament features a wide range of sporting events, including athletics, badminton, volleyball, basketball, cricket, football, carrom, table tennis, cycling, and kabaddi. Approximately 885 players from 28 ICAR institutions across the South Zone are participating in the event, comprising 750 men and 135 women athletes.
The ICAR South Zone Sports Tournament aims to promote camaraderie, teamwork, and a spirit of healthy competition among ICAR personnel while encouraging physical fitness and overall well-being.
